Ticoffia is a cafe, located at 151, Provincia de Guanacaste, Coco, Costa Rica. They can be contacted via phone at +506 2670 1444, visit their website www.ticoffia.com for more detailed information.

    Great CR coffee served Chemex style with a CR ceramic pot. Owner explained coffee sourcing for their varietals of coffee, the brewing method, and how she would like to introduce filtered 1st harvest coffee to Costa Ricans and make it more popular. One of the cleanest and earthiest coffees I enjoyed in 3 months of Central American travel. Worth the higher than backpacker-level expense.
